Understanding How it Works
For those new to using tools for ADHD organization and note-taking, it's essential to understand how these tools work. Generally, these tools are designed to help individuals stay organized by providing features such as reminders, calendars, and to-do lists. Note-taking tools, on the other hand, offer features like tagging, categorization, and search functions to help individuals quickly find and review their notes. By leveraging these tools, individuals with ADHD can better manage their time, prioritize tasks, and retain information.

What are the Best Tools for ADHD Organization?
When it comes to choosing the best tools for ADHD organization, it ultimately depends on individual preferences and needs. Some people may prefer digital tools like Trello or Asana, while others may find physical planners more effective. It's crucial to experiment with different options to find what works best.
How Do Note-taking Tools Help with ADHD?
Note-taking tools can significantly help individuals with ADHD by providing a structured way to capture and review information. These tools can help reduce distractions, improve focus, and enhance retention of material.

Common Misconceptions
One common misconception is that individuals with ADHD are lazy or lack motivation. In reality, ADHD is a neurodevelopmental disorder that affects executive function, making it more challenging for individuals to stay organized and focused.
